May 2025 - Apr 2026Portsmouth Road area has the 11th lowest crime rate of 36 local areas in Heatherside , and the 66th lowest crime rate of 290 local areas in Surrey Heath .
Compared with the surrounding streets, this postcode does not stand out as either a particular hotspot or an unusually safe pocket. Crime levels in the neighbouring output areas are broadly in line with this area.
The overall crime rate in the area around Portsmouth Road (GU15 1HT) in the last 12 months was 16.6 per 1,000 residents and was 33.6% lower than the Heatherside average (25.0 per 1,000 residents). In the last 12 months, this area’s most reported crimes were Violence and sexual offences with 3 offences recorded. The least common crime was Burglary with 1 case , unchanged from 2025. All major crime categories fell. The sharpest drop was Anti-social behaviour ( -33.3% YoY).
Violent crimes totalled 3 (≈ 8.3 per 1,000 residents). Year-over-year these were flat ( 0.0% ). Over the last decade, overall crime has falling ( -19.0% comparing early vs recent averages) .
In the area around Portsmouth Road (GU15 1HT), the main crime hotspot is near Scarlet Oaks. Police recorded 24 crimes here, including 4 violent or public-order offences. All these locations are within roughly 0.3 miles.
